Prayer for Slaughtering the Sacrifice on Eid al-Adha
After performing the blessed Eid al-Adha prayer, Muslims proceed to slaughter their sacrifices, one of the greatest Sunnahs that distinguish this noble day. It is recommended for the person slaughtering to recite the prayer reported from Jabir ibn Abdullah (may Allah be pleased with him), where the Prophet Muhammad (peace be upon him) said:
“I have turned my face towards He who created the heavens and the earth, upright, and I am not of the polytheists. Indeed, my prayer, my sacrifice, my living, and my dying are for Allah, Lord of the worlds, who has no partner. And with this I have been commanded, and I am the first of the Muslims. O Allah, from You and to You, for Muhammad and his nation.”
This prayer expresses sincerity of intention and true devotion to Allah alone, making the act of slaughtering a complete and continuous worship.Etiquettes and Conditions for Slaughtering the Sacrifice
The sacrifice is not merely slaughtering; it is a great act of worship representing obedience and sacrifice for the sake of Allah.
The sacrifice must be from the animals prescribed by Shariah, such as goats, sheep, cows, and camels, and must be free from defects that invalidate it.
The person performing the sacrifice must be a Muslim, sane, adult, and capable of slaughtering.
It is Sunnah to slaughter the sacrifice oneself or delegate someone trustworthy, with a sincere intention for Allah alone.
Best Times to Slaughter the Sacrifice
Slaughtering starts after sunrise on the 10th of Dhul-Hijjah, specifically after performing the Eid prayer and the two units of Duha prayer, and continues until sunset on the third day of Tashreeq.
Although slaughtering during the day is preferred, Shariah allows slaughtering at night too, as night and day are considered a continuous time unit.
This timing accommodates all Muslims, whether in cities or villages, facilitating the performance of this great ritual as prescribed by the Prophet (peace be upon him).
Warnings and Ethics of Slaughtering the Sacrifice
Muslims should observe order and proper etiquette during slaughtering and avoid causing disturbance or harm to others, such as:
Avoid slaughtering in public roads that may cause annoyance or danger.
Maintain cleanliness of the place after slaughtering.
Consider the safety of others, especially children and the elderly, and avoid creating chaos or disturbance.
Adhere to humane behavior and show mercy to the animal even at the moment of slaughter, as mercy is part of the religion.
Virtues of the Sacrifice and Its Spiritual and Social Impact
The sacrifice is not just slaughtering an animal; it is a message of faith, a full submission to Allah’s command, and a renewal of the spirit of sacrifice embodied by the story of Prophet Ibrahim (peace be upon him) and his son Isma’il.
The sacrifice also strengthens bonds of love and compassion among Muslims by distributing its meat to the poor and needy, thus achieving social solidarity and supporting the spirit of brotherhood in society.Summary
